Achieving optimal sound also involves paying attention to room acoustics, which can significantly impact the listening experience.

Speaker positioning plays a vital role in achieving ideal sound. You want your speakers to be placed at ear level when you’re seated, forming an equilateral triangle with your listening position. Avoid placing them too close to walls or corners, as this can cause bass distortion or muddy sound. Instead, position them a few feet apart, allowing sound waves to disperse evenly throughout the room. Experimenting with angles can also help; slightly angling speakers inward toward your listening spot often produces clearer stereo imaging. The goal is to create a balanced soundstage that feels natural and immersive, with no single element overpowering the others.

Additionally, make certain your record player is on a stable, vibration-free surface. Vibrations can distort playback and cause unnecessary wear on your records. Use isolation pads or a dedicated stand if needed. A vibration control system can further enhance playback stability and protect your collection. Moreover, choosing the right record cleaning tools can significantly improve sound quality and prolong the lifespan of your records. Once your turntable is steady, check the tracking force and anti-skate settings to prevent excessive wear on your records and stylus. Regularly cleaning your records and stylus also ensures that dust and debris don’t compromise sound quality.

How Often Should I Replace My Turntable Stylus?

You should replace your turntable stylus every 500 to 1,000 hours of use, depending on your stylus lifespan and how often you listen. Typically, this means replacing it every 6 to 12 months with regular use. Keep an eye out for signs of wear like distortion or reduced sound quality. Following the recommended replacement frequency guarantees your vinyl sounds its best and prevents damage to your records.

Can I Use Any Mat on My Turntable?

You shouldn’t use just any mat on your turntable; choose one designed for vinyl playback to optimize sound quality. Quality turntable accessories, like specific mats, help reduce vibrations and static, improving sound clarity. For vinyl maintenance, stick with mats that protect your records and keep dust at bay. Always select mats compatible with your turntable to guarantee proper tracking and longevity, making your listening experience richer from the very first play.
